Hyper-V重装Ghost系统启动失败解决方案
Hyper-V重装ghost后无法启动

首页 2025-01-03 11:11:23



Hyper-V重装Ghost后无法启动:全面解析与解决方案 Hyper-V作为微软的一款虚拟化产品,在提高系统性能和安全性方面发挥着重要作用

    然而,许多用户在重装Ghost系统后发现Hyper-V无法正常启动,这给他们带来了诸多困扰

    本文将深入探讨这一问题,并提供全面而有效的解决方案

     一、Hyper-V概述及其重要性 Hyper-V是微软推出的虚拟化技术,允许用户在一台物理计算机上运行多个操作系统

    通过Hyper-V,用户可以创建和管理虚拟机,从而实现资源的有效利用和系统的灵活配置

    Hyper-V不仅提高了系统的性能,还增强了系统的安全性,成为企业和个人用户不可或缺的工具

     二、重装Ghost系统后Hyper-V无法启动的原因 重装Ghost系统后,Hyper-V无法启动的原因可能多种多样

    以下是一些常见的原因及其详细分析: 1.硬件兼容性问题 Hyper-V对硬件有一定的要求,特别是虚拟化技术的支持

    如果计算机硬件不支持虚拟化技术(如Intel VT或AMD-V),或者这些技术没有在BIOS/UEFI中启用,那么Hyper-V将无法正常工作

     2.Windows版本与更新状态 Hyper-V仅支持在特定版本的Windows上运行,如Windows专业版、企业版或教育版

    如果系统未更新到最新版本,或者安装了不支持Hyper-V的Windows版本,那么Hyper-V将无法启动

     3.组策略与注册表设置 在某些情况下,组策略或注册表设置可能会阻止Hyper-V的启动

    如果用户在安装Ghost系统时对这些设置进行了更改,或者Ghost系统本身包含了不兼容的设置,那么Hyper-V将无法正常工作

     4.驱动程序冲突 重装Ghost系统后,原有的驱动程序可能会与新系统不兼容,导致Hyper-V无法启动

    特别是与虚拟化技术相关的驱动程序,如果未正确安装或更新,将直接影响Hyper-V的功能

     5.虚拟机保存状态冲突 如果用户在重装Ghost系统前未正确关闭Hyper-V虚拟机,那么虚拟机的保存状态可能与新系统不兼容,导致虚拟机无法启动

     三、全面解决方案 针对重装Ghost系统后Hyper-V无法启动的问题,以下是一些全面而有效的解决方案: 1.检查硬件兼容性 首先,用户需要确认计算机硬件是否支持Hyper-V

    可以通过查看处理器的规格说明或运行Windows的任务管理器(在性能选项卡中查看“CPU”信息)来检查是否支持虚拟化技术

    如果硬件不支持,用户可能需要考虑升级硬件或选择其他虚拟化解决方案

     同时,用户还需要进入BIOS/UEFI设置界面,找到与虚拟化技术相关的选项(如Intel VT或AMD-V),并确保它们已被启用

    保存设置并重启计算机后,再次尝试启动Hyper-V

     2.确认Windows版本与更新状态 用户需要确保正在使用的是支持Hyper-V的Windows版本(如Windows专业版、企业版或教育版)

    同时,检查系统是否已更新到最新版本

    可以通过Windows更新设置来检查并安装可用的更新

     如果系统版本不支持Hyper-V,用户可能需要考虑升级Windows版本或安装其他虚拟化软件

     3.检查并修改组策略与注册表设置 如果怀疑组策略或注册表设置导致了Hyper-V无法启动,用户可以尝试以下步骤: -组策略:打开本地组策略编辑器(gpedit.msc),导航到“计算机配置”>“管理模板”>“系统”>“Hyper-V”,检查是否有任何策略被设置为禁用Hyper-V

    如果有,请将其更改为“未配置”或“已启用”

     -注册表:使用注册表编辑器(regedit)导航到与Hyper-V相关的注册表项(如`HKEY_LOCAL_MACHINESYSTEMCurrentControlSetServicesVmms`),检查是否存在不兼容或错误的设置

    如有必要,可以手动修改或删除这些设置

     请注意,在修改注册表之前,务必备份当前注册表,以防出现意外情况

     4.更新或重装驱动程序 如果驱动程序与新系统不兼容,用户可以尝试更新或重装这些驱动程序

    特别是与虚拟化技术相关的驱动程序,如Hyper-V的集成服务组件

    可以通过访问微软官方网站或计算机制造商的官方网站来获取最新的驱动程序

     在更新或重装驱动程序之前,建议用户先卸载原有的驱动程序,并重启计算机以确保更改生效

     5.检查虚拟机保存状态 如果用户在重装Ghost系统前未正确关闭Hyper-V虚拟机,那么虚拟机的保存状态可能与新系统不兼容

    此时,用户可以尝试以下步骤来解决问题: -删除保存状态:在Hyper-V管理控制台中,右键单击无法启动的虚拟机,并选择“删除保存状态”选项

    这将删除虚拟机的保存状态文件,并允许虚拟机在新系统上重新启动

     -手动删除文件:如果删除保存状态选项无效,用户可以手动导航到虚拟机文件夹,并找到包含虚拟机保存状态的GUID文件夹

    然后,手动删除这些文件夹中的`.bin`和`.vsv`文件

    完成此操作后,虚拟机应该能够在新系统上正常启动

     6.重置系统或寻求专业支持 如果以上方法均无法解决问题,用户可能需要考虑重置系统或寻求专业的技术支持

    在重置系统之前,务必备份重要数据以防丢失

    如果问题依然存在,建议联系微软技术支持或计算机制造商的客户服务部门以获取进一步的帮助

     四、预防措施 为了避免重装Ghost系统后Hyper-V无法启动的问题再次发生,用户可以采取以下预防措施: 1.备份重要数据 在重装系统之前,务必备份重要数据以防丢失

    这包括虚拟机文件、系统配置文件和任何其他重要数据

     2.检查系统兼容性 在重装系统之前,确保新系统支持Hyper-V

    这包括检查硬件兼容性、Windows版本和更新状态等

     3.关闭虚拟机 在重装系统之前,务必关闭所有Hyper-V虚拟机并删除其保存状态

    这可以避免虚拟机保存状态与新系统不兼容的问题

     4.更新驱动程序 在重装系统之前,确保所有驱动程序都已更新到最新版本

    这可以避免驱动程序与新系统不兼容的问题

     5.寻求专业支持 如果用户对重装系统和虚拟化技术不熟悉,建议寻求专业的技术支持以确保操作正确无误

     五、总结 重装Ghost系统后Hyper-V无法启动是一个复杂而常见的问题

    通过检查硬件兼容性、确认Windows版本与更新状态、检查并修改组策略与注册表

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道